CVS => SVN Migration
Folks,
[sorry for the cross-post]
Please see the test SVN repo (don't try to check-in code there :). You
can check out the code and run whatever tests you need to run. Please
take this week till friday (Aug 26th) 12:00 Noon EST to do what ever
testing you need to do and report any problems to general@ws. If all's
well, we can lock down the CVS repo at 12:00 Noon EST and move it to
our regular repo (test->asf in url below). Please raise any objections
ASAP. If we decide to move things around and rename them (say axis1 ->
axis and axis ->axis2) we can do that later. Let's use this round to
make sure that no information is lost or corrupted.
Thanks,
dims
Test SVN Repo :
http://svn.apache.org/repos/test/webservices/
Modules that need migration:
ws-addressing : /webservices/addressing
ws-admin : /webservices/admin
ws-axis : /webservices/axis1
ws-juddi : /webservices/juddi
ws-site : /webservices/site
ws-soap : /webservices/soap
ws-wsif : /webservices/wsif
ws-wss4j : /webservices/wss4j
Modules already handled:
ws-jaxme : ALREADY DONE
ws-kandula : ALREADY DONE
ws-sandesha : ALREADY DONE
ws-xmlrpc : ALREADY DONE
Others:
ws-fx : MOTHBALLED (Have asked infra to archive)
ws-wsil : MOTHBALLED (Have asked infra to archive)
ws-wsrp4j : PORTALS PMC (Not our problem)
